Para-sports week concludes at Kulgam & Bandipora
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

Srinagar: Para-sports week activities culminated today at Sports Stadium, Kulgam where concluding events and award distribution function was held in the presence of Deputy Commissioner Kulgam, Dr Bilal Mohi-ud-din Bhat.

The week-long event was organized by District Youth Services & Sports Department from the Ist of May and more than 300 para-sports persons of all age groups from across the district participated in cricket, tug of war, carrom, and chess.

Deputy Commissioner, Dr. Bilal Mohi-ud-Din Bhat, who was present as Chief Guest, along with SSP, Sahil Sarangal participated in carrom, tug of war events on the concluding day.

Speaking on the occasion, DC congratulated the department for organizing the event and facilitating the appreciable participation of para-sports persons.

He also lauded specially-abled para sports persons who showed great temperament and enthusiasm by their participation in the events held since day Ist.

He also held interaction with them and enquired about the issues. They apprised him of some prominent demands like better sports infrastructure and provision of easy accessibility.

On the occasion, the Deputy Commissioner directed for making all efforts in the coming days to resolve their issues.

He instructed the YSS department to put up a comprehensive proposal for funds allocation for the benefit of para-sports in the district.

He also instructed to organize more of these para-sports events at zonal, and district levels.

The event was attended by other civil, police officers along with concerned from the department.

Later, the Deputy Commissioner inspected the under-construction Indoor Badminton stadium at Kulgam and took stock of its work, which is at the final stage of execution.

It was intimated that the project cost of the stadium is 90 lacs. The DC directed for immediate takeover and dedication of the facility for the sports lovers of the district.

At Bandipora, the Department of Youth Services and Sports Bandipora today concluded “Para Sports Week” at District Headquarters which was celebrated this past week.

In the week-long activities, specially-abled children were involved in various sports activities. The motive of the activities was to encourage these children to take up any sport for personal and professional development.

During the programme, children were informed about the benefits and career aspects of para-sports as per the Sports Policy of J&K 2022.

Sports activities included Yoga, Carrom, Tug of War, Badminton, Chess, and other recreational activities, etc.

On the Occasion, Nazir Ahmad, Secretary of All J&K Handicapped Welfare Association was the Chief Guest. Sports personalities from across the District were present to encourage the specially-abled students.
